    Some pre-sale questions

    Hi! I want to buy vBSEO for my forum. I want to know.

    1. Can I use different, unique domain for my Blog not similar with my forum's domain?
    2. Can I use subdomains in my blog, e.g. username.blogdomain.com?
    3. Can I use vBSEO for my other modes, such as Arcade, Gallery etc?
    4. Is the 149 USD of vBSEO for a lifetime license and what about updates?

    Thanks

    Hi Hayk,

    1) vBSEO relies on the Forum URL defined in vBulletin AdminCP. As this only allows one domain, you might have difficulty. Also, as each vBulletin Blog is attached to a license, and each license can only be attached to a single domain, you might run into issue with vBulletin's licensing rules.

    2) See 1.

    3) vBSEO is compatible with most modifications to vB out-of-the-box, but if you have issues with any modification, you can open a Support Ticket or post a thread and we will do our best to get it working.

    4) Your vBSEO license is indeed a lifetime license, with access to the Support System and Upgrades requiring a yearly renewal (currently $35/year).

    I understand now.

    vBSEO is licensed for one unique domain only, and rewrites URLs dependant on the vBulletin Forum URL defined in AdminCP.

    To have your blog URLs use the vbblogger.com URLs you would need to have your Forum URL defined in the AdminCP as vbblogger.com.

    vBSEO will work for the domain it is licensed to.

    If you have multiple domains pointing at the same content, that is something that is viewed by the Search Engines as Duplicate Content, and not something we suggest or support.
